  • Abstract
    The field of Network Centric Warfare seeks to use information technology in order to gain competitive advantage over the enemies during war. An essential part of network centric warfare deals with the firing of highly destructive weapons. It includes the determination of exact direction of firing the weapon so as to successfully destroy the target for a given unguided shell. This can be done using different trajectory models. The major challenge is that this decision be quick in the time critical scenario of war and this urges the use of previous experience using data mining.
